There are too many factors to call anything at this point. I recently read an old issue of Edge from fall 2005 where the Xbox 360 was described as a Playstation 2.5 in terms of power compared with the PS3 and that the console race was over before it had begun.

We simply don't know how this will actually play out with actual games and actual consumers beyond the hardcore, or what the real world implications will be or what will become the must-have features.

Maybe Kinect 2.0 and voice and gesture control of the UI will capture the zeitgeist, or maybe Sony or Microsoft will release must-have, generation-defining game of some kind.
